We are looking for a DevOps Engineer who can manage our server, automate deployment, monitor and ensure zero downtime.
What do we look for in an interview?
● Ability to communicate effectively and precisely
● Very good problem-solving and logical thinking skills
● Complex challenges you have worked on
● What are you passionate about
● Are you ready to work in a challenging environment with high ownership
● Must have AWS hands-on, especially on EKS, ECR, EC2, RDS and IAM
● Must have very good knowledge in Kubernetes, Elastic search, Fluentbit, Grafana and
Prometheus
● Knowledge of Azure, and Google Cloud
● Knowledge of CI/CD tools Github Actions, Jenkins, Sonarqube, Elastic search
● Knowledge of rest API, different types of authentication, Deploying high availability
systems
● Strong knowledge of SQL and NoSQL
● Knowledge of Docker
● Knowledge of Unix commands, log analysis, and performance monitoring
● Ability to come up with a solution for a given problem
● Ability to think out of the box
● Ability to work as part of a team
What does your day-to-day job look like?
● Participate in product/sprint planning meetings
● Participate in technical solutions with your team or tech lead
● Estimate and provide a due date for the requirement
● Ensure zero downtime of servers
● Attend stand-ups
● Provide ideas and fine-tune existing product
● Take bugs as pride and ensure it’s fixed asap and never occur
● Analyze server logs, performance metrics and ensure servers are running with zero
downtime
● Setup monitoring tools, provision servers/access
● Help your team to achieve goals
● Challenge yourself/your team for a better solution
● Monthly Demo your work/achievement to the entire team/company
● Work on personal project/open source
● Lastly Lots of learning, and fun